The Plain Mountain-Finch ("Leucosticte nemoricola") is a species of finch in the Fringillidae family.It is found in Afghanistan, Bhutan, China, India, Kazakhstan, Myanmar, Nepal, Pakistan, Russia, Tajikistan, and Turkmenistan.Its natural habitat is temperate grassland.
